Consent alone won’t protect you under Article 7 of the GDPR. Employees cannot freely refuse monitoring when their job depends on it—the power imbalance invalidates “freely given” consent entirely. Legitimate interest plus a legitimate interest assessment (LIA) is the path forward. Document why surveillance is necessary, show less intrusive alternatives were evaluated, and demonstrate that employee privacy impact stays proportional to the business need. Article 22 adds another layer of restriction. Automated decision-making that produces “legal effects” on employees—think promotion eligibility scores or performance rankings—triggers explicit opt-in rights regardless of your consent strategy.

Germany’s Bundesdatenschutzgesetz (BDSG) imposes even tighter constraints. Section 26 limits processing to what’s “necessary” for the employment relationship, not what’s convenient for productivity analytics. Brazil’s LGPD mirrors GDPR on consent validity but adds Article 10 requirements: employees must receive “clear and adequate information” about processing purposes before any tool deployment begins.

California’s CCPA/CPRA treats employee data as personal information. SB 362 mandates employers disclose categories of automated decision-making technology in use within 90 days of a verifiable employee request. China’s PIPL takes a different approach entirely. Articles 13 and 14 require explicit opt-in consent with granular purpose specification—blanket policies covering “all monitoring activities” violate transparency requirements under Chinese law.
